It has been hypothesized that because music has the ability to motivate, promote relaxation, alleviate pain and anxiety levels, to distract, and facilitate positive emotional states; thus it will enable healing by reducing anxiety levels which are associated with expected pain, hence patients are more unperturbed. In addition, several studies in the past have also identified that music listening can reduce the need for analgesics before surgery and after surgery to alleviate pain, reduce the period of post-operative pain and aid in the recovery period. While most studies which had administered music listening in the post-anaesthesia care unit (PACU), had found significant findings compared to patients that did not listen to music; there are few others which found otherwise. Over decades, time and again, researchers have tried to understand how non-pharmacological interventions have been utilized in a spectrum of rehabilitation settings in populations to stimulate convalesces. This is because non-pharmacological interventions have been recognised as valuable, simple, safe, and inexpensive adjuvants to pharmacological approaches in pain management and therefore is valuable during post-operative rehabilitation especially. This research is necessary because it hopes to address the gap of knowledge concerning the effects of music in post-operative pain, anxiety objectively in a specific population, and during an explicit time frame in a public hospital setting in Malaysia and whether by listening to music, the patients will require lesser amount of opioids analgesics. The purpose of this study is to examine the effects of music on pain and anxiety during post-operative period in patients with closed shaft femur fracture at University of Malaya Medical Centre.

Pain score using the Numeric Rating Scale (NRS)
Timeframe: The change between the baseline and post-intervention will be assessed. The intervention is for 30 minutes long and will be administered 24 hours post surgery.
